Role Specific Information

A single decision can have many outcomes, and when that decision affects hundreds of thousands of customers and employees, it needs to be the right one. Thats where Credit and Fraud Risk comes in.

At American Express, Risk Management forms the backbone of all financial services operations. It affects every aspect of the company globally. Join us this summer, and youll get to know all the areas of our business from consumer cards to small-business services, corporate services, and merchant partners. Plus, youll work with the industrys top Risk Management teams, developing strategies, leveraging Machine Learning and overseeing how recent news events impacts our customers. Positions in Risk Management lead the development of credit, operational, enterprise, and fraud policies designed to profitably grow the portfolio, while ensuring excellent customer experience. These policies utilize mathematical models and other techniques to understand and predict customer behavior. At the analyst level, the employee is beginning to develop expertise in the field. Receives general instruction on moderately complex problems and issues.

Our well-established Summer Internship Programme will provide candidates with the opportunity to gain hands-on experience in projects that have strategic, operational, and financial significance to the company. Interns will have the opportunity to work on a challenging project, with an opportunity to learn about the culture and values of American Express, as well as network across regions and functions.

Skills/Experience

Strong analytical, project management, relationship, and problem-solving skills Excellent verbal and written communications skills, this position collaborates with diverse stakeholders, including marketing, sales, operations, business partners as well as external vendors Ability to effectively implement initiatives through partnerships and alignment with multiple stakeholders Effective team player and ability to manage multiple responsibilities

Requirements/Qualifications

Currently enrolled in a full-time undergraduate degree programme (degree in quantitative field or equivalent experience such as business, finance, statistics, economics, science, engineering, or mathematics) in your penultimate year of study. Students must graduate in 2026 Experience in Python/ SQL/ R /Hive or other statistical programming experience is preferred along with working knowledge of MS Office Students must graduate between June - September 2026
